Understanding the Soil aeration frequency is vital for long-term botanical success. At its core, aeration is the process of creating small holes or pathways in the earth to allow air, water, and nutrients to penetrate directly to the roots. Roots are living organisms; they must respire. When soil becomes heavily compacted, the microscopic air pockets collapse. Without these pockets, oxygen cannot reach the root zone, and carbon dioxide cannot escape. This hypoxic environment creates a breeding ground for anaerobic bacteria, which are the primary culprits behind devastating conditions like root rot.

For individuals cultivating a collection of house plants, managing this is especially critical. The confined space of a pot means that continuous watering naturally pushes soil particles closer together over time. Proper aeration allows the potting matrix to dry out evenly, preventing soggy bottoms that drown root systems. Enthusiasts often look to resources like Essential Indoor Plants to learn about specific species requirements, but the fundamental rule across all species is that healthy dirt breathes.

Furthermore, aeration drastically improves water infiltration. Compacted dirt causes water to pool on the surface and run off, meaning that even if you are watering your plants or lawn adequately, the moisture is evaporating before it reaches the deep root zones. By maintaining a proper aeration schedule, you encourage deep, robust root growth rather than shallow, weak roots. This makes your plants significantly more drought-resistant and structurally stable.

Lastly, aeration stimulates the microbiome of the soil. Beneficial microorganisms, which are responsible for breaking down organic matter into bioavailable nutrients (like nitrogen and phosphorus), require oxygen to thrive. Regular aeration essentially supercharges the biological engine of your garden or potted plants, leading to lusher foliage, brighter blooms, and higher vegetable yields.

To get the most accurate and beneficial results from the calculator, it is crucial to input precise information about your current gardening situation. Follow these step-by-step user guidelines to ensure optimal accuracy:

  • Assess Your Environment: Choose where your plant lives. Indoor potted plants rely entirely on the limited space of their container and lack natural aerators like earthworms. Lawns face heavy foot traffic and mowers, while garden beds sit somewhere in the middle. Be honest about the environment to get the right baseline frequency.
  • Identify Your Soil: Take a handful of your dirt. If it feels sticky and forms a tight ball, it is likely heavy clay. If it feels gritty and falls apart instantly, it is sand. Loam is the perfect middle ground, crumbly yet moisture-retentive. Potting mix is typically peat or coco-coir based and very light. Correct soil identification is the most critical variable in the formula.
  • Determine Compaction Levels: Observe how water behaves. If you water your plant and it immediately pools on top and takes a long time to drain, your compaction is "High." If it drains steadily, choose "Medium." If water flows straight through almost instantly, choose "Low." For lawns, try pushing a screwdriver into the turf; if it requires immense physical force, you have high compaction.
  • Apply the Results Sensibly: The tool provides a customized timeline. However, use your best judgment. If the calculator suggests aerating a houseplant every month, use a gentle tool like a wooden skewer or chopstick to poke small holes without severing major roots. If it suggests aerating a lawn annually, rent a core aerator for the best results.

Knowing exactly when and why you should use these tools comes down to observing the physical symptoms your plants and soil are exhibiting. Nature provides distinct warning signs when oxygen deprivation is occurring. You should immediately use the calculator and plan an aeration session if you notice any of the following symptoms.

First, monitor the water flow. The most obvious indicator of a problem is surface runoff. In potted plants, you might notice that the dirt pulls away from the sides of the pot, causing water to bypass the root ball entirely and drain directly down the sides. In a lawn or garden, puddles will form after a light rain. This means the surface tension is too high and the pores are crushed. Aeration is necessary to break that surface tension.

Second, look at the physical health of the plant. Yellowing leaves (chlorosis), stunted growth, or a sudden drop in vitality despite proper fertilization are classic signs of root suffocation. The plant is essentially starving because, without oxygen, roots lose the physical ability to absorb nutrients. You should use aeration tools to immediately reintroduce oxygen into the system, allowing the biological pathways to reopen.

Third, for outdoor environments, heavy traffic is a massive catalyst. If you recently hosted an event on your lawn, had construction equipment drive over the yard, or if children frequently play in a specific area, the soil underneath is suffering from severe mechanical compaction. You should aerate in the early spring or fall when the grass is in its active growing phase, allowing it to quickly recover from the stress of the aeration process itself.
